A feisty cat fight is on tap when the Choctaw County Tigers take on the Shields Panthers at 7:30 p.m. on Friday...
Last Wednesday, Choctaw County lost to Shields at home by a 54-35 margin. The Tigers were down 46-20 at the end of the third quarter, which was just too much to recover from.

Even though the team lost, they still had their share of impressive performances. One of the best came from Jarrod Chaney, who went 5 for 9 en route to 10 points along with seven rebounds and three steals. He is on a roll when it comes to steals, as he's now grabbed two or more in the last five games he's played. Another player making a difference was Jaydon Thomas, who posted eight points.
The win was the third in a row for Shields, bringing their record for this year to 7-5. Those victories came thanks to their offensive performance across that stretch, as they averaged 59.7 points per game. As for Choctaw County, they have traveled a rocky road recently having lost five of their last six matches, which put a noticeable dent in their 5-11 record this season.
